How to Cut a Face Mask with your Cricut Maker or Explore Air 2

[videojs youtube=”http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=yZ2DHRiJsYM”]
Have a Cricut machine? You can cut out the fabric with your Cricut Maker or cut out a template with your Explore machine.

I’ll even show you how to cut through 3 layers of fabric at once on your Cricut Maker!
